With Jesse James (acoustic guitar/lead vocals) and Oatmeal Reed (bass/dirty vocals) at the helm, Black TarPoon tells tales of loss, addiction, and so-called hillbilly life. Jesse and Oatmeal are ed by Jesse’s wife and Oatmeal’s sister Tashia The Don on washboard/backing vocals, Jesse’s father Billy Mo on lead guitar/backing vox, Scooby Davidson on fiddle and family friend Chi Chi Picante on drums. The band says of their tongue-in-cheek name, “We assure you it’s not slang for a woman’s private parts. We use the word ‘poon’ as in a foolish person. The name is basically an anti-heroin reference. We’ve had loved ones away due to heroin overdose… Heroin can make the best of us fools.”

The band tell us:

Black TarPoon was born in the heat and humidity of Corpus Christi Texas. Our music can be described as Hillbilly Punk and some would put us in the category of Folk Punk or Dark Country. Our goal is to transcend what has already been done in these genres and pump up the production value to put our album next to a classic album and not tell the difference in age or quality. We’re ready to release our sophomore full length album: Probable Caws

Recorded over the last year, this 12 song album is a combination of what we’ve become over the last 7 years. We feel this is the best record we’ve ever worked on, better than any of our music in the past. In short, it’s going to make you move. We have so many guest musicians on this album! We have Gary Lindsey of Black Eyed Vermillion, Jared McGovern of Urban Pioneers, Liz Sloan McGovern of Urban Pioneers, Bil Zarate of Black Eyed Vermillion, Kurtis Machler, Black Eyed Vermillion, Alvaro DelNorte of Pinata Protest, Jonny Swagger of Tail Light Rebellion, Jessica “Mauz” Pietrzykowski of Tail Light Rebellion and Tim Vee of Duane Mark and his solo project. The album was recorded with Matthew Roussel of Harbor City Sound Labs as engineer, and produced by Kurtis Machler of Black Eyed Vermillion and Million Dollar Sound, as well the mixing and mastering, Kurtis has worked many legendary roots and punk acts. With their wry lyrics, skillful songwriting, and an authentic dose of South Texas grit, Black TarPoon is a band to watch.

  • Jesse James – Acoustic guitar, Lead Vocals
  • Oatmeal Reed – Bass and Low end vocals
  • Tashia the Don – Washboard, backup vocals
  • Billy Mo – Lead guitar, backup vocals
  • Scooby Davidson – Fiddle
  • Chi Chi Picante – Drums

Matthew Roussel of Harbor City Sound Labs as engineer, and Kurtis Machler of Black Eyed Vermillion and Million Dollar Sound producing, mixing and mastering.

Guest musicians:

  • Gary Lindsey – vocals on Moth Song
  • Jared McGovern – banjo on W.T R.W.Y.R
  • Bil Zarate – banjo on The Dogs
  • Kurtis Machler – Piano on The Dogs
  • Alvaro DelNorte – accordion on Poor Old St. Peter
  • Liz Sloan McGovern – fiddle on Head on a Pike
  • Jonny Swagger – Mandolin on Down by the Willow Garden
  • Jessica “Mauz” Pietrzykowski – accordion on Down by the Willow Garden
  • Tim Vee – Mandolin on Swing
